DH World Cup: Myriam Nicole wins in Val di Sole. Widmann 7th

Myriam Nicole wins hands down the last stage of the World Cup Downhill in Val di Sole. Camille Balanche brings home the general. Veronika Widmann 7^, first of the Italians.

Flags from all corners of the world, the noise of chainsaws, the roar at the entrance of the final kick: in a nutshell, the day most felt by the Val di Sole, where is the Downhill it is an authentic religion. Saturday 3 September, the arena of Daolasa of Commezzadura has been inflamed since the morning waiting for the tightrope walkers of Downhill and of the final act of the specialty World Cup.

Source: Vitesse press release

When the game is hard, Myriam Nicole proves once again that it has an edge. The disappointing World Cup at home in Les Gets did not affect the certainties of the transalpine rider in view of the Grand Final of the World Cup in Val di Sole.

World Champion in 2021 on the Black Snake, the rider of Team Commencal was the author of a superb first part of the race, where she proved to have something more than her rivals on the more technical sections.

Behind him, the German Nina Hoffman (Santa Cruz Syndicate, +4.069), revelation of the season and increasingly at ease on selective tracks like the one in Trentino, and the Austrian World Champion Valentina Hell (Rockshox Trek, +6.235), third. The fifth position, on the other hand, was sufficient for the Swiss Camille Blanche (Dorval Am Commencal +10.637) to take home the points needed to win the overall standings of the World Cup.

Games with podium hopes, the blues failed to give themselves a joy in front of the home crowd: the South Tyrolean Veronika Widman (Madison Saracen), finished in sixth position at 17.178 from the winner, while she finished in ninth position in the thirty Eleonora Farina (Mondraker Team +24.117), thanks to a crash in the first part of the race.

"It was a difficult season, but usually when I don't have the pressure of the result at all costs I can give the best of myself", said Myriam Nicole. - "The track today was "bad", a real battle: I did not reach the maximum this weekend after a very disappointing World Championship for me, but I wanted to give great satisfaction to my team. The Black Snake is fun and challenging at the same time, in the end a pedal came off and I couldn't push as I wanted in that section, but that's okay ”.

“I'm over the moon, winning the World Cup is a dream come true. I can't even speak from how tired and excited I am. It was a perfect season despite the injury and the operation. To get back to racing so quickly I had to ask a lot of my body and now I feel empty and happy: it will take me a while to realize what happened. I knew I had the ability to complete the test, but I lacked the energy to hold the bike and to push. Being able to get on the stage podium today has a special flavor ", Camille Balanche's comment.

"It didn't go as I hoped, but overall this season remains very positive", Eleonora Farina said. - “Unfortunately I compromised the race with a crash in the first part of the course. Then, due to the impact, I no longer had the necessary feeling with the bicycle but also thanks to the support of the public I was able to complete the race. The track turned out to be very selective, but the Black Snake is like that. Now the holidays are waiting for me and then I'll start thinking about next season ”.
